  • Patent number: 12436287
    Abstract: The present invention relates to a lidar system including: laser transmitter and receiver systems, the laser transmitter system including: a wavelength-tunable seed laser which emits pulses at selected wavelength points, and switches between wavelengths within a switching time of <200 ns; a fiber amplifier which amplifies the laser pulses up to 200 kW to a transmitter grating; and a transmitter telescope including primary and secondary mirrors. The laser beam is directed from the transmitter grating to the secondary then primary mirrors, and the first transmitter grating is imaged on the primary mirror to minimize laser beam wander thereon. The transmitter grating diffracts and steers the laser beam by wavelength to a surface, to an arbitrary subset of <2000 resolvable footprints along a cross-track direction at a beam pointing angle switching time of <200 ns, such that footprints illuminated by the laser beam on the surface are imaged in 3D.

  • Patent number: 11965799
    Abstract: An electromagnetic signal detector includes a photonic crystal substrate, an antenna disposed on the substrate and having an active feed region and a ground region spaced apart from one another by a gap, a photonic crystal disposed on the substrate at the gap, and an electro optic polymer disposed on the photonic crystal.

  • Patent number: 11852864
    Abstract: An arrayed waveguide for a photonic integrated circuit has a single optical path with serially connected delay lines. Different delayed optical paths or channels are periodically split off from the serially connected optical delay path. This has the net result of requiring much less space on-chip for comparable optical path differences with high spectral resolution.

  • Publication number: 20080110548
    Abstract: To apply a resin impregnated fabric to a substrate, a device includes a surface having a layer of material and a first edge. The surface moves relative to the substrate and to conform to the substrate. The layer of material is compatible for use with the resin. The first edge is disposed at the front of the surface relative to the movement of the device to the fabric. The first edge is curved with a center portion of the first edge being relatively forward of a pair of side portions of the first edge.
